Operating & Safety Rules

Definitions
- Facility: The area within the fenced perimeter, including all buildings, swimming pool, tennis courts, grass, and cement areas.
- Grounds: The entire property, including the Facility, parking lot, and landscaped/unimproved areas.
- Member: Any individual included in a Family or Senior Membership.
General Rules
- The Club Manager has authority over all activities on AHSTC grounds and may delegate authority to an Assistant Manager.
- Members and guests must obey AHSTC staff at all times. Failure to follow rules will result in:
- Verbal warning
- Time out from the pool or tennis courts
- Dismissal from the Facility or Grounds
- Guests: Must be accompanied by a member and follow all rules (Guest Policy).
- Check-In: Members and guests must check in at the office upon entry and list guest names. Members arriving early for team practice must check in when the Facility opens.
- Damage to Club property by members or guests will be charged to the responsible member. Parents should instruct children to report vandalism.
- All individuals must treat others with respect. Physical or verbal abuse, gossip, intimidation, and harassment will not be tolerated.
- Profanity and improper behavior are prohibited. Bullying will not be tolerated (Abuse Prevention Policy).
- Respect others’ belongings. Items should not be moved from chairs or tables unless the member has left the Grounds.
- During high demand, adults have priority for tables and lounge chairs. Unused tables/chairs may not be reserved.
- No pets are allowed inside the Facility.
- Kitchen and BBQ areas must be cleaned after use. Do not leave dirty dishes in the sink.
- No glass items are allowed in the Facility.
- Members and guests must clean up after themselves. Trash and recycling must be disposed of properly.
- No food or drinks are allowed within four (4) feet of the pool edge.
- Jumping or standing on furniture is prohibited.
- Bicycles, scooters, and skateboards are not allowed inside the Facility.
- Radios may only be used with earphones.
- Use of tobacco, cannabis, vaping, and e-cigarettes is prohibited anywhere on the Grounds.
- Alcohol consumption is allowed in moderation and must be discreet.
- Boys over age six (6) are not permitted in the women’s bathhouse. Girls over age six (6) are not permitted in the men’s bathhouse.
- Diaper changing stations are available in both bathhouses.
- Cell phone use in bathhouses is strictly prohibited.
Pool Safety & Sanitation
- All individuals must shower with soap before entering the pool.
- Persons with infections, open wounds, or bandages are not permitted in the pool.
- Pollution of the pool (urinating, spitting, eating, etc.) is strictly prohibited.
- Children under four (4) feet in height must pass a swim test to enter the pool without an adult.
- Children under eight (8) must be accompanied by an adult at all times.
- Children using flotation devices must be supervised in the water by an adult at all times (2:1 ratio).
- Running, wrestling, dunking, or rough play is not allowed.
- Walking is required on the pool deck.
- No diving in the shallow end.
- No flips or backward dives from the pool edge.
- Swimming in the dive tank is allowed only when diving boards are closed.
- Use of pool toys is allowed but may be restricted during high occupancy.
- Throwing tennis balls in the pool or on the deck is not allowed.
- Hanging on lane lines is prohibited.
Diving Board Rules
- Only one person is allowed on the diving board at a time.
- Only one bounce is allowed.
- No diving from the sides of the board.
- Divers may not dive into another person’s arms.
- Divers must exit the dive tank immediately.
- No flotation devices or goggles are allowed on the diving boards.
Special Operations
- Adult Swim: No one under 18 is allowed in the pool during this time (weekends and holidays).
- Early Bird Swim: Open to lap swimmers age 13+ in the morning. Exceptions may be granted by the Club Manager.
